  1. Most of our cap casualties are already on the books. We already have an 18 million dead cap number. Tyrod saves us like 10 million if we cut him or trade him. The roster bonus of 6 mil plus the 10 mil base means he's unlikely to be traded unless for pennies, and would likely need his deal re-done. He knows he'll never suit up here under his current deal. If he projects as a high end backup (which i think he does when you watch Cassel, Foles, Schaub, Hoyer etc) - then that would put him in the 6 to maybe 8 mil top end per year range. Foles got 2 years 11 million last year. I look at Tyrod and see him backing up either a younger QB, or an oft injured guy like bradford where you know you can't roll into a season with a bad backup QB. He wouldn't be a cut target, but i could see trying to move him in a trade (as he's overpaid though you're likely to get a dareus level return or worse)

  13. I mean - 20 of 55 sacks were in 2 10-sack games against HOU week 1 and IND in week 7. Considering they played them both two more times... they got 28 of 55 sacks in 4 games against HOU and IND. They're a good... even a great defense. But they are not as good as numbers indicate.

  21. We need to run the ball well and with likely tolbert as the lead back, i want to see more traps/powers. Rely on his ability to move it a bit more north/south, and less on his cutbacks. He's alright on one cut runs but he's not making a guy miss in the backfield and that seems to be the trend on our zone running scheme. Get him going with a full head of steam. This would help put us in manageable third downs. I've liked how they've gone empty on some of the 3rd and mediums as it helps open up the middle of the field, and prevent blitzes.
